Failed findings

  • toxic items stored near food
    Official wording: No Evidence Of Rodent Or Insect Outer Openings Protected/Rodent Proofed, A Written Log Shall Be Maintained Available To The Inspectors
    Inspector note: OBDERVED SEVERAL SMALL FLYING INSECTS ON CEILING, WALLS, SHELVES AND BOXES AT REAR. MUST REMOVE. SERIOUS VIOLATION 7-38-020.
    code 18
  • food prep surfaces dirty
    Official wording: Food And Non-Food Contact Equipment Utensils Clean, Free Of Abrasive Detergents
    Inspector note: CLEAN FOOD STORAGE SHELVES AT REAR ABOVE PREP TABLES AND WHERE NECESSARY TO REMOVE OLD FOOD BUILD-UP.
    code 33
  • Walls, Ceilings, Attached Equipment Constructed Per Code: Good Repair, Surfaces Clean And Dust-Less Cleaning Methods
    Inspector note: CLEAN/SANITIZE WALLS ABOVE 3-COMP SINK AT REAR OF FOOD SPLASHES/BUILD-UP. MUST CLEAN. SEAL OPENINGS INTO WALL AROUND TUBING AT REAR BY 3-COMP SINK AND WHERE NECESSARY.
    code 35
  • pests in the house
    Official wording: Ventilation: Rooms And Equipment Vented As Required: Plumbing: Installed And Maintained
    Inspector note: COLD WATER VALVE AT 3-COMP SINK IN REAR STRIPPED. MUST REPAIR.
    code 38
